A cosplayer has donned garb befitting a warrior of the gods with a spectacular Assassin's Creed costume.

The cosplayer (u/CyperianWorkshop) shared a photo of the detailed costume on Reddit. The outfit is a faithful recreation of Bayek of Siwa's Servant of Amun skin as seen in the Assassin's Creed: Origins DLC, The Curse of the Pharaohs. The costume matches the major components of the in-game skin with a gold-colored metallic mask, dark leather headwraps, silvery arms, dark clothes beneath the armor, a golden belt ornament with simulated jewels and a replicated leopard skin. CyperianWorkshop also included two legendary items in their Bayek display — the weapon Palmette Carver and the shield Mut's Sorrow.

The armaments and the outfit are exclusively available through the Assassin's Creed title's second DLC, The Curse of the Pharaohs. It takes place four years after the conclusion of Origins' main story and brings Bayek to Thebes, where long-dead pharaohs are terrorizing its citizens. The Palmette Carver is the only item of these three that can be obtained in the DLC's main quest line, specifically after taking it from a shadow warrior of Anubis in the mission Blood in the Water. Mut's Sorrow and the Servant of Amun outfit can be claimed in the side quests Follower or Leader and Shield or Blade, respectively.

Who Is Bayek in Assassin's Creed?

In this installment of the Ubisoft franchise, Bayek is originally a warrior in the village of Siwa. He is put on a path of vengeance after his son is murdered by members of the Order of the Ancients — the precursors to the Templar Order. Both he and his wife, the renamed Amunet, follow their revenge to the far reaches of Egypt and beyond to slay the five responsible for their child's death. However, the pair discover that the Order extends far beyond, and they create a faction of their own in order to oppose it. The order is named the Hidden Ones, and it would go on to become the modern Brotherhood of Assassins seen throughout the Assassin's Creed franchise.
